A further large explanation the whole world has a water crisis is usually that governments often don't deal with water properly. Even when a country has adequate water, poor setting up, weak laws, and unfair selections might cause significant problems. In many places, water is just not shared rather. Lots of people, especially those in wealthy neighborhoods or potent organizations, get lots of clear water, while others in very poor locations get little or no or none whatsoever. Often governments Create large water initiatives like dams or canals, but these only enable some folks and depart out entire communities. Very poor water arranging also triggers waste and shortages. In some nations, water is employed without the need of restrictions. Large farms or factories just take as much water as they need from rivers or underground, and the government does not monitor it. This will cause overuse, wherever water is taken more rapidly than character can replace it. Also, water bills may be much too cheap or not gathered in the least, so folks do not check out to avoid wasting water.

The dihydrogen monoxide parody began as being a amusing joke during the early nineteen nineties. It had been intended to indicate how utilizing huge science text can confuse individuals and make Risk-free items audio hazardous. "Dihydrogen monoxide" is just a elaborate way of saying water. The phrase “dihydrogen” suggests two hydrogen atoms, and “monoxide” usually means one oxygen atom.
